    Me, I would do this:

    5 years, $50M, Front loaded

    Year 1: $12M
    Year 2: $11M
    Year 3: $10M
    Year 4: $9M
    Year 5: $8M


    Rationale: it diminishes risks associated with age and attitude while also allowing the team to have more financial flexibility moving forward. Age is straight forward - he is paid less as he gets older. Attitude means if this year was not a fluke, if he is owed the bulk of his contract in later years it is only going to make it that much harder to get rid of him. Financial flexibility is straight forward.



    I would be ecstatic if it could happen at $11, $10, $9, $8, $7 (i.e. 5 years and $45M)


    He is 33 coming off a five year deal.
